Detailed Guide to Setting Up the HP Color LaserJet Enterprise MFP 5800

Introduction:

The HP Color LaserJet Enterprise MFP 5800 is a versatile multifunction printer designed for demanding office environments. Setting up this printer can be straightforward, but following a step-by-step guide can ensure a seamless installation.

Step 1: Unpack and Prepare the Printer

  • Unpack the printer and all its components.
  • Remove all protective materials and packaging.
  • Install the toner cartridges by opening the front cover, removing the old cartridges, and inserting the new ones.

Step 2: Connect the Printer

  • Connect the power cord to the printer and a wall outlet.
  • Connect the Ethernet cable to the printer and your network or computer. Alternatively, you can use Wi-Fi or USB connectivity.

Step 3: Install the Software

  • Insert the HP software CD into your computer.
  • Follow the on-screen instructions to install the printer drivers and software.
  • If the CD is unavailable, download the software from HP’s website.

Step 4: Configure Network Settings

  • Open the printer’s control panel by pressing the home button.
  • Navigate to the “Network” or “Wireless” menu.
  • Follow the on-screen instructions to configure your network settings.

Step 5: Perform Initial Setup

  • Once the printer is connected, it will prompt you to perform an initial setup.
  • Follow the instructions on the display to set the date, time, and other printer preferences.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

1. Printer Not Responding

  • Ensure that the printer is turned on and properly connected to power.
  • Check the Ethernet or USB cable connections.
  • Restart the printer by turning it off and on again.

2. Poor Print Quality

  • Check the toner levels and replace any empty cartridges.
  • Clean the printheads by following the instructions in the printer’s user manual.
  • Adjust the print settings to improve quality.

3. Paper Jams

  • Open the printer’s paper tray and remove any jammed paper.
  • Check for any obstructions in the paper path.
  • Reload the paper correctly and ensure it is properly aligned.

4. Wi-Fi Connectivity Issues

  • Make sure your printer is within range of your Wi-Fi network.
  • Check if your network is working correctly.
  • Restart both your printer and router to resolve connectivity problems.

5. Scan Problems

  • Ensure that the scanner is enabled in the printer’s control panel.
  • Check the connection between the scanner and your computer.
  • Update the scanner driver if necessary.
